Jack of all trades

You’ve probably heard the phrase: “Jack of all trades, master of none.” Most people use it as an insult. Like being good at many things… is somehow a bad thing. But here’s what they don’t tell you. That phrase isn’t complete. The full phrase actually says: “Jack of all trades, master of none… but oftentimes better than a master of one.” In other words— someone who can do many things adapt, learn, and solve problems… can be more valuable than someone who only knows one thing. So the next time someone says “Jack of all trades…” Just remember… The real phrase was never meant to be an insult.
